1. Understand the Risk

Betting and casino games involve real financial risk. Users should understand that results are not guaranteed and that losing money is always possible.

Betting should never be treated as a fixed income source, investment method, or solution for financial problems.

2. Only Play If You Are 18+

Betting-related content is intended only for users who are at least 18 years old or above the legal age required in their region.

Minors should not access betting platforms, casino games, gambling pages, or promotional betting offers.

3. Check Local Laws

Betting and online gaming rules may vary depending on the user’s country, state, or local region.

Users are responsible for checking whether betting-related activity is legal in their area before using any betting platform.

4. Set a Budget Before Playing

Before placing any bet, users should decide how much money they can afford to lose without affecting daily expenses, savings, family needs, or financial responsibilities.

Never use borrowed money, emergency funds, rent money, loan payments, or essential savings for betting.

5. Do Not Chase Losses

Chasing losses means betting more money to recover previous losses. This can quickly increase financial pressure and lead to unsafe behaviour.

If a user loses money, the safest decision is to stop, take a break, and avoid making emotional betting decisions.

6. Take Breaks and Control Time

Users should avoid spending too much time on betting or casino games. Long sessions can make it harder to make clear and responsible decisions.

Taking regular breaks helps users stay aware of their time, budget, emotions, and betting behaviour.

7. Avoid Betting Under Stress

Users should avoid betting when they feel stressed, angry, tired, upset, pressured, or under the influence of alcohol or other substances.

Clear thinking is important when making any money-related decision.

8. Recognize Warning Signs

Warning signs may include hiding betting activity, borrowing money to bet, chasing losses, ignoring responsibilities, or feeling unable to stop.

If betting starts causing stress, financial problems, or personal conflict, users should stop and seek help from trusted people or professional support services.
